What Is Shift Work Sleep Disorder (SWSD)?

Sleep isn’t just about how long you’re in bed-it’s also about timing and quality, especially if your hours clash with your body’s internal clock. If you work nights or rotating shifts, you might have Shift Work Sleep Disorder (SWSD). It occurs when your schedule forces you to be awake during your body’s natural sleep phase, causing circadian misalignment. That means your internal clock is out of sync with your work and sleep times. You likely experience sleep fragmentation-frequent interruptions that reduce deep, restorative sleep. You may struggle to fall asleep, wake up too often, or feel exhausted despite sleeping. These sleep issues aren’t just fatigue-they’re symptoms. SWSD can impair focus, mood, and long-term health. Recognizing it helps you decide whether to pursue structured sleep routines, light therapy, or talk to a doctor about options like melatonin or prescription aids. Early action supports better sleep and overall well-being.

Why Night Work Disrupts Your Body Clock

Your body runs on a natural rhythm set by light and darkness, and when you work nights, that rhythm gets thrown off. This shift causes circadian misalignment, where your internal clock conflicts with actual day-night cycles. Normally, light exposure in the morning signals alertness, but at night, it tricks your brain into thinking it’s daytime. Even dim light can suppress melatonin, making sleep harder. When you’re awake during typical rest hours, your body struggles to regulate hormones, digestion, and alertness. Over time, this misalignment affects performance and health. Managing light exposure-like wearing blue-light-blocking glasses or using blackout curtains-can help realign your rhythm. Prioritizing consistent sleep schedules, even on days off, supports better adaptation. These practical steps don’t fix the root issue, but they reduce strain and improve sleep quality, helping your body cope with night work demands.

Leptin, Ghrelin, and Insulin: The Shift Work Hormone Shift

Even though you can’t see them, hormones like leptin, ghrelin, and insulin are quietly steering your appetite and energy storage, especially when shift work throws off your normal rhythm. When your sleep schedule flips upside down, you’re likely facing a hormonal imbalance that skews how hunger and fullness signals work. Leptin, which tells your brain you’re full, drops, while ghrelin, the hunger trigger, rises-leading to appetite dysregulation. That late-night snack craving? It’s not just willpower; it’s biology. Insulin, which manages blood sugar, also becomes less effective over time, making energy storage less efficient. These shifts happen subtly, but they impact your daily choices. You don’t need a prescription to start addressing this-prioritizing consistent sleep hours, even on days off, helps. Some find sleep aids useful short-term, but check with a provider to avoid interactions.

Why Shift Work Raises Your Risk of Metabolic Syndrome

Because your body’s internal clock regulates more than just sleep, disrupting it through night shifts or rotating schedules can quietly increase your risk of metabolic syndrome. This happens mainly due to circadian misalignment, where your body’s natural rhythms fall out of sync with daily environmental cues like light and darkness. When this occurs, your hormones, blood pressure, and glucose levels don’t follow their usual patterns, leading to metabolic dysregulation. You might not notice it at first, but over time, these disruptions can raise insulin resistance, increase abdominal fat, and alter cholesterol-all key markers of metabolic syndrome. Your body simply isn’t designed to function ideally during nighttime hours. Maintaining a consistent sleep schedule-even on days off-can help reduce this risk. Consider speaking with a healthcare provider about sleep aids or behavioral strategies if rest remains difficult.

Late-Night Eating and Inactivity: Common Pitfalls (And Fixes)

A common challenge for shift workers is the tendency to eat late at night and remain inactive during off-hours, which can worsen sleep quality and contribute to weight gain. Night snacking often stems from disrupted hunger signals, making high-calorie foods more appealing when you’re tired. Meanwhile, sedentary habits during your downtime can further slow metabolism and interfere with restful sleep. You might find it hard to stay active after a long shift, but light movement-like walking or stretching-can help reset your body clock. Planning meals earlier in your wake cycle supports better digestion and energy use. Limiting screen time before bed reduces cravings linked to night snacking. Small changes, like standing during phone calls or preparing healthy snacks ahead of time, make a difference. You don’t need intense workouts-consistent, low-effort activity helps break sedentary patterns and supports long-term metabolic health. Proven Ways for Shift Workers to Protect Metabolism

While your schedule may not follow the typical day-night rhythm, you can still support your metabolism with consistent, practical choices. Proper meal timing helps align your body’s internal clock-even if you work nights, eating meals at the same times daily stabilizes insulin response. Avoid large meals right before sleeping, and aim for balanced nutrients to maintain energy. Physical activity, even in short bursts, improves insulin sensitivity and supports weight control. Try a 10-minute walk after shifts or simple resistance exercises at home. Consistency matters more than intensity. Pair these habits with efforts to improve sleep quality, like using blackout curtains or white noise machines. If sleep problems persist, consider discussing sleep aids with a healthcare provider. Small, regular adjustments in meal timing and physical activity make a measurable difference in long-term metabolic health.
